Great.. I just noticed something. AF-6 does not have the "dorsal fin" antenna on it's back that previous F-35's had. There is also 4 new antenna (two on top in front of the vertical stab and two underneath.

| SWP, the white antenna is for the flight sciences jets only. You'll notice that AF-3, BF-4, etc will have a similar config to AF-6. The four "antennas" are not antennas. They are a "safety measure" for peacetime flying. |
